Quick Stats Box

  • Total Time: 25-30 minutes including warm-up and cool-down
  • Equipment Needed: Resistance band (light to medium resistance)
  • Difficulty Level: Beginner-friendly to Intermediate
  • Calories Burned: Approximately 150-250 calories depending on intensity

Warm-Up (5 Minutes)

  1. Arm Circles: 30 seconds forward, 30 seconds backward
  2. Leg Swings: 30 seconds per leg
  3. Bodyweight Squats: 10 reps
  4. Torso Twists: 30 seconds
  5. Standing Side Stretch: 30 seconds per side

Full Body Resistance Band Workout

Complete in: 20 minutes

| Exercise Name | Reps/Durations | Sets | Rest | Form Cue | Modification | |--------------------------------|----------------|------|-----------------|-----------------------------------|---------------------------------------| | Resistance Band Squats | 12 reps | 3 | 45 seconds | Keep your chest up and back straight | Use a chair for support | | Resistance Band Rows | 12 reps | 3 | 45 seconds | Squeeze shoulder blades at the top | Perform seated if needed | | Resistance Band Chest Press | 12 reps | 3 | 45 seconds | Maintain a flat back, press straight | Perform seated or on the ground | | Resistance Band Deadlifts | 12 reps | 3 | 45 seconds | Hinge at hips, keep back flat | Reduce resistance by using a lighter band | | Resistance Band Overhead Press | 12 reps | 3 | 45 seconds | Keep elbows slightly in front | Perform seated or reduce reps | | Resistance Band Bicycle Crunches| 30 seconds | 3 | 45 seconds | Engage your core and twist slowly | Perform with feet on the ground |

Cool-Down (3-5 Minutes)

  1. Standing Quad Stretch: 30 seconds per leg
  2. Seated Hamstring Stretch: 30 seconds per leg
  3. Child’s Pose: 1 minute
  4. Cat-Cow Stretch: 30 seconds

Conclusion

This resistance band workout is perfect for busy professionals looking to fit in an effective full-body session at home. You can perform this routine 3 times a week, allowing for rest days in between to promote recovery.

Progression Path

  • Easier: Reduce reps or use a lighter band.
  • Standard: Follow the prescribed sets and reps.
  • Harder: Increase resistance by using a heavier band or add an additional set.
  • Advanced: Incorporate more complex movements or increase tempo for an added challenge.
